#7437e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7437e5 is composed of 45.5% red, 21.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 76%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 261 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 55.7%. #7437e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e86eff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7437e5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7437e5 has RGB values of R:116, G:55,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 7616485.

Hex triplet 7437e5 #7437e5
RGB Decimal 116, 55, 229 rgb(116,55,229)
RGB Percent 45.5, 21.6, 89.8 rgb(45.5%,21.6%,89.8%)
CMYK 49, 76, 0, 10
HSL 261°, 77, 55.7 hsl(261,77%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 261°, 76, 89.8
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 41.378, 62.939, -77.909
XYZ 22.709, 12.102, 75.264
xyY 0.206, 0.11, 12.102
CIE-LCH 41.378, 100.155, 308.933
CIE-LUV 41.378, 7.203, -115.681
Hunter-Lab 34.788, 55.642, -103.921
Binary 01110100, 00110111, 11100101

Shades and Tints of #7437e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040108 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fe is the lightest one.
